## Fi1m on Cameron Monaghan

> Cameron Monaghan grew up on screen as Ian Gallagher in *Shameless*, and the long, patient, unusually honest story he and Noel Fisher were given there is still his best work. Films have since billed him high and used him little.

The Gallagher kitchen in *Shameless* is loud, and most of the family are loud in it. Ian is the one who is not. Monaghan played him from 2011 to 2018, from a teenager to a man, and for most of those years what he does is listen: to Fiona, to Lip, and later to Mickey Milkovich, who arrives to make his life difficult and stays to make it something else. It is a performance built in small pieces over a long time, which is the only way that kind of performance gets built.

The story Ian and Mickey get is the show's best and its most honestly written, and we say that having admired Rossum's Fiona more than anyone else in it. It crept up on us. We had sat down for a comedy about a drunk and his children, and somewhere in the middle seasons we realised the thread we were waiting for each week was the quiet one between Monaghan and Noel Fisher, because the writers refuse to hurry it and the two actors refuse to plead for it. Ian is gay and, as the run goes on, bipolar, and Monaghan plays both as facts of a life rather than as subjects for an episode. He has said he read first-person accounts of the disorder and talked to people who have it, and it shows in how little he performs it.

Around it he did the loud work. On *Gotham* (2014–2019) he played twins, Jerome and Jeremiah Valeska, the series' long tease towards the Joker, a job that asks for the opposite of listening. We have not reviewed it and will not judge it here. Since leaving *Shameless* he has done more of his acting in voice and motion capture, as Cal Kestis in *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order* (2019) and *Survivor* (2023), where the face the player sees is built by other people from what he gives them.

The films have been less kind. He was in *The Giver* (2014), and he is Caius in *TRON: Ares* (2025), billed prominently and on screen so briefly that we came out with no clear memory of him, which is a fault of the cutting rather than of anything he did. That has become the pattern. Television and games give him years to build a person; a film gives him a name on the poster and a few minutes to justify it.

He has been working since he was five, in commercials first and then guest parts, so he has the patience. What he has not yet had is a film that wants him for the thing *Shameless* found in him, which is the knack of sitting in a loud room and being the one worth watching. Someone should give him a quiet part and ninety minutes and see what happens.

## Biography

Cameron Monaghan is an American actor and model. Born on 16 August 1993 in Santa Monica, California, he began working as a child model at the age of three and as a child actor at seven.

He is known for his role as Ian Gallagher in the series *Shameless* (2011–2021) and as the twins Jerome and Jeremiah Valeska in *Gotham* (2014–2019). Earlier credits include *Click* (2006), *The Giver* (2014) and guest appearances in *Malcolm in the Middle* (2000–2005) and *Avatar: The Last Airbender* (2005). He also voices Cal Kestis in the video games *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order* (2019) and *Star Wars Jedi: Survivor* (2023). Monaghan plays Caius in the film *TRON: Ares* (2025). He has received nominations for a BAFTA Award and a Critics' Choice Television Award.
